Understanding Encapsulation in Programming

Software Encapsulation Concepts

In the dynamic world of software development, 'Encapsulation in Programming' stands as a fundamental principle, especially in object-oriented programming (OOP). This article dives deep into encapsulation, a strategic approach that not only enhances code robustness and security but also clarifies its structure. Encapsulation involves bundling data and methods within a class and controlling access

